HEROIC AURIC ACTING Unless you forego the media entirely, you’re going to hear the incessant drumbeat of Oscar commentary right up until the awards are given, at which point the post-Oscar commentary will begin. So why not let the international obsession become a way to practice your Deeper Perception? As an aura reader or empath, you can do a kind of research that gets to the very core of a great performance. Extraordinary acting doesn't merely involve looking the part, getting the words out so they'll be heard, putting on a convincing expression, or singing if you’re playing a singer. Sure, these acting requirements are enormous challenges. But the best acting also changes chakras. This year, I finally figured out a way to research this. For each “Best” nominee, I compared a still photo from the nominated role with a photo of each performer being herself or himself. Although I haven’t seen any of these films yet, I sure want to. And, like any skilled aura reader, I can read auras while watching those movies. It’s like wearing 3-D glasses, only more interesting. Research shows who can supplement the tough technical requirements of acting with the ability to change all the way down to each chakra. Only two nominees for Best Actor managed this neat trick. Heath Ledger altered every one of his major chakras, going from a complex, confident hetero male to the brooding, loveable hero of “Brokeback Mountain.” What could be as courageous as going public with an entirely different sexual orientation? How about playing one of America’s most popular (and quirkiest) country musicians? Biopics have built-in audience appeal, but what a challenge to take on aura characteristics of a real-life character! Joaquin Phoenix did better than just play the part of Johnny Cash. He channeled him. Correction—he did better than channeling Cash. Whereas a trance channeler, for example, is taken over by an entity, Phoenix performed a real synthesis. While very conscious, definitely acting on his own, he managed to also shift his aura into an uncannily accurate match with the real-life subject. Read the difference yourself.
How can you read auras from photos? Here’s the simplest way:
Let’s compare throat chakras here. You go first. Then read below the pieces of the puzzle that I found in my research. Joaquin as himself: A wild sense of humor is the man’s most distinctive quality. Regarding masculinity, Phoenix has it but doesn’t flaunt it in the way he communicates. Instead, resourcefulness matters more, as though he possesses a huge repertoire as a communicator. Which, of course, the next photo confirms that he does. Joaquin as Cash: Rough, tough communicator. A burbling font of testosterone. Make that a fountain with gravel in it! Cash as Cash: He’s an awful lot like Joaquin as Cash. Male oomph is the major attraction. The real Cash is tougher, more cynical, but not by much, compared to the portrayal by Phoenix. Overall: Read other chakras from this trio of pictures (as you can, with more advanced methods that some of you may know) and you’ll find that Phoenix consistently makes a major shift into being Cash—earthy as can be, un-empathic, and compellingly honest. OSCAR'S WOMEN How well did the Best Actress nominees do at morphing their auras? No contest! They performed way better than the men. Every one of the these talented women convincingly shifted her chakras. The least adept was Charlize Theron, who “only” managed to totally shift two chakras. At the root chakra, she morphed her big, star quality glamour into the auric display of a frightened and, in some ways, passive character. At the heart chakra, gorgeous Charlize shifted convincingly, too, from her usual focused, happy self to a strongly different heart, maternal in ways far beyond Theron’s present life experience. But the big aura reader’s joke here is what didn’t change in this Oscar-nominated performance: A super-charged, mega-glamorous, movie-star-sexy second chakra. Sure it doesn’t fit in the role but it sure does attract. And who, exactly, is going to complain? All the other nominees in this set of Best Actress nominees for 2006 did the near impossible. They managed to morph all their chakras to create a completely different character. Here I’d like to give special acknowledgement to Reese Witherspoon for her real-as-life, down-to-the-chakras match-up with June Carter.
